US Surrogacy Costs: Determining Your Total Expenses
The cost of surrogacy in the United States can vary wildly, ranging from around $40,000 to well over $100,000. This wide range is influenced by a number of factors. Location plays a significant role, with surrogacy in major metropolitan areas often costing significantly more than in rural regions. The agency you choose can also impact the overall price, as some agencies have higher fees. The complexity of your case, including factors like multiple embryo transfers or the need for pre-implantation genetic testing (PGT) , can also add to the cost .
Furthermore, medical expenses, charges associated with legal representation, and travel costs for both the intended parents and the surrogate must be factored in. Being aware of these factors can help you create a more accurate budget for your surrogacy journey.
